Mrs uses Grisport boots for dog-walking, has been through one and a half pairs on ten years. Lightweight, goretex, vibram soles, 'like slippers'. Very impressive. About 65 squids iirc si deffo not overkill for dog walking but they do punch way above their weight for the price. I would buy the mens/unisex equivalent if was in the market with similar requiremts.

*Edit. Grisport Peaklander unisex. Spotex membrane. Check reviews on that big shopping website. Better still try some if you can.
